Probable
Ancestry of James Davidson
|
| |
| Assuming that
James Davidson was actually born in Aberlemno in
1811, the probability of his ancestry is laid out
here. There is, however, some confusion
regarding the parishes of Aberlemno and Forfar,
and is a possibility that the James Davidson who
married Mary Smith was born in Forfar and not in
Aberlemno. A closer look into the Old
Parochial Records of the parish of Forfar have
not yet produced any further confirmation of this
- so please consider the ancestry of James
Davidson to be nothing more than a probable
scenario. This
Davidson line, however, can be followed with
documentation from William, son of James born in
1811 in Aberlemno, Angus, Scotland, there onward.
- Alexander Davidson
christened 8 February 1716 in
Aberlemno who married Helen Nichol.
- James Davidson
christened 9 June 1745 in Aberlemno
who married Isabel Irvine.
- James Davidson
christened 25 May 1777 in Aberlemno
who married Janet Ross.

JAMES
DAVIDSON 1748 VS. JAMES DAVIDSON 1745 |
| |
Born
within a few years of each other, Old Parochial
Records offer two possibilities for the
grandparents of James Davidson who was born in
1811 and was listed in these records as the son
of James.
There was found in
these records a James Davidson who married on the
7th day of June in 1745 in Aberlemno, an Ann
HEPBURN who had been born in Inverarity and
Methy, in the shire of Angus, who had had a son
James born in Aberlemno on the 28th of April in
1748. Although Ann Hepburn, like her husband, can
not be proven as yet to be the grandmother of
James, the parochial records state she was the
daughter of Andrew Hepburn. Only one other child
is listed in the parochial records for James and
Ann (Hepburn) Davidson besides their son James -
this being daughter Elizabeth who had been
christened in Aberlemno on the 27th of September
1750.
The Old Parochial
records also listed a James Davidson who was born
on the 9th of June in 1745, son of Alexander
Davidson (christened on the 8 Feb 1716 in
Aberlemno) and his wife Helen NICOL whose
marriage record does not appear in the Aberlemno
records. One other child is listed in the records
as their child, this being John who was
christened in Aberlemno on the 27th of September
1747.

| JAMES
DAVIDSON & ISABEL IRVINE |
Although not
verified, an examination of the Old Parochial
Records indicates that the parents of James
Davidson born in 1811 are more probably James
Davidson and Isabel IRVINE. As no other James
Davidson was born in the parish between the
births of the James 1745 and James 1748, it would
seem likely then that the son James who was born
to James Davidson and Isabel Irvine, is the
father of James Davidson who was born in 1811. As
this seems the case, a listing of what appears to
be all of James and Isabels children, is
given below taken from the Old Parochial Records
of Aberlemno.
Ann
Davidson - christened 1 Sep 1771; may
have married William Hunter 26 Jul 1794.
Elspet
Davidson - christened 13 Dec 1772; may
have married John Henderson 17 Aug 1790.
Jean
Davidson - christened 14 Feb 1775.
James
Davidson - christened 25 May 1777.
Robert
Davidson - christened 23 May 1779.
Charles
Davidson - christened 4 July 1781; may
have died early.
Agnes
Davidson - christened 30 Sep 1783; may
have married William Brown on 16 July
1810.
Charles
Davidson - christened 23 Apr 1786; may
have married Margaret Donald on 9 July
1808.
Katherine
Davidson - christened 3 Apr 1789; may
have married David Petrie on 10 Dec 1814.
Isabel
Davidson - christened 4 Dec 1791; may
have married John Binny on 14 June 1817.

JAMES
DAVIDSON & JANET ROSS
An
examination of the 1851 census record for
Aberlemno taken on the 30th of March, listed
James Davidson as born in Forfar/Aberlemno and
his recorded age on the census as 41, leading to
conclusion (by verifying the births in the Old
Parochial Records of Aberlemno) that the only
possible James Davidson was the son of James
Davidson and Janet Ross. The only possibility
that this James Davidson was not the son of James
and Isabel Irvine, would be if another James
Davidson of a parish other than Aberlemno,
married Janet Ross in Aberlemno. According to
parochial records, Janet was born in Aberlemno on
the 25th of December in 1781 and was the daughter
of Charles Ross. Upon examining the records for
the children of James Davidson and Janet Ross,
only two children are listed, lending to the
possibility that Janet may have died after the
birth of their second son James. Thus far, there
are no death or burial records which can confirm
Janets death, but it does seem likely.
|
Children
of
James Davidson & Janet Ross
- George
Davidson - born 18 April in
Muirside Melgand and christened
on the 23rd day of April 1809 in
Aberlemno - appears to have
married Charlotte Louden.
- James
Davidson - born 24 July 1811 in
Crosstown, Angus, Scotland;
christened 31 July 1811 in
Aberlemno, Angus, Scotland. He
married Mary SMITH.

| Upon checking the
parochial records only one George was found, and
he is listed as having married Charlotte Louden
on the 15th of August 1835. They are listed
in the 1841 and 1851 Aberlemno, Angus County Census of
Scotland. |
| |
Children
of George Davidson & Charlotte Louden
Listed in the
Old Parochial Records
- Mary
Ann Davidson - born 6 September
1835 in Aberlemno, christened 6
September 1835.
- James
Davidson - born 26 June 1837 in
Aberlemno, christened 3 July
1837.
- George
Davidson - born 11 August 1839 in
Aberlemno, christened 28 August
1839.
- Alexander
Davidson - born 14 May 1842 in
Aberlemno, Angus, Scotland.
- William
Davidson - born 14 January 1845
in Aberlemno, christened 28
January 1845.
